QuoteYoruba is a metaphorical language. Many of the words were created centuries ago and where not meant literal. The literal definition for Akata is wildcat. But it means a person who is not born in Africa because of slavery. Oyinbo literally means man with the peeled skin. But it meant to describe a white person. Overtime, Africans took these words and used them in rude tones and the context may have changed a little because of the hostility between Africans and African Americans. But in most cases when people say this it?s not meant to be disrespectful.

The unbalance started in the late 90's
Back in the 70's, 80's and 90's when African countries started gaining independence from their old colonial masters, A.A's always commended them for their efforts, even helped them, "Black Power" was a thing.
Africans in turn admired A.A's for the Black Panthers and Civil rights movements and tried to mimic that movement over there.
The inbalance started from when Western blacks began to show disdain for Africans (largely helped along by white people's narrative on Africa), those who left the continent felt they were better than those who couldn't afford to leave. Those who were born in the West didn't want to associate themselves with they were convinced were poor dirty, uncultured savages. Africans in return began to show disdain for their western counterparts who were often portrayed as ghetto and violent and lazy.
It's not really each people's fault.
Divide and conquer is truly in effect.
